What makes a great leader today is different from what made them in the past.
Many leaders work incredibly hard at driving performance and productivity at all costs. And while it might get results short-term, it’s at the detriment of long-term performance and employee wellbeing.
In more recent times, the importance of taking care of the wellbeing of staff has come to the forefront – not just because we’re more aware of anxiety, depression and other mental health concerns, but because it’s better for business. Productivity is higher, staff stay longer and new talent is easier to attract.
No longer can leaders just focus on performance. Now they must give equal attention to helping to enhance the wellbeing of their staff.
They need to get their own sh*t together before they focus on helping their team members. They need to change their own habits and develop positive and long-term habits to live a healthier life, physically, mentally and emotionally.
But anyone who has tried to go on a diet or start an exercise program knows that sustaining new habits for more than a few weeks or months is not easy.
